Jefferson Cross Country Teams Finish Season Strong

The  Jefferson Cannoneer men's and women's cross country team had an outstanding showing at the NJCAA Division III National Cross Country meet this weekend held by Holyoke CC at Stanley park in Westfield, MA.

The men ran extremely well with 5 of the 7 runners setting personal bests for the 8K distance and were led by yet another solid performance by Alex Hall who set a personal best by 37 seconds.  He was followed by James Lamson who missed a personal best by a mere 14 seconds, Michael McLane (personal best by 1 min 9 sec), Evan Morine (personal best by 3 min 5 sec), Dakota Rookey, Nicholas Kogut (personal best by 1 min 56 sec) and Arthur Campbell (personal best by 2 min 27 sec)

The women were led by Kurstyn Macaulay who finished 22nd in the team scoring and was followed by a strong showing by the women with 3 out of the 7 runners setting personal bests for the 5k distance; Cori Mainville (personal best by 41 sec), Reganne Smith (personal best by 2 sec), Nola Pominville, Andrea Smith, Lauren Bianco, and Megan Denise (personal best by 2 sec)).  The lady cannoneers also picked up an outstanding performance by Andrea Smith who has been the lady cannoneer's 6th runner all season and stepped up this past weekend into the 5th spot finishing 88th in the team scoring.
